Assassin’s Creed Valhalla, Monster Hunter World Crossover: The action role-playing game Monster Hunter World by Capcom and the role-playing game Assassin’s Creed Valhalla by Ubisoft have just announced a new crossover event.

As part of the cooperation, players of Assassin’s Creed Valhalla can now outfit their Eivor, ride, and scout with skins modeled after the most recognizable creatures in Monster Hunter World.

Those who have been playing the Ubisoft video game for a long time will not find this crossover occurrence surprising. A recent data mine for Assassin’s Creed Valhalla hinted at the inclusion of new armor sets, including those from Destiny 2 and Monster Hunter World.

Last year on December 1st, the Destiny 2 armor was finally added, proving the validity of the data mine. A few weeks later, a Monster Hunter World–themed armor set has been added to Assassin’s Creed: Valhalla.

The crossover between Assassin’s Creed Valhalla and Monster Hunter World was recently announced on Twitter by Ubisoft. The post also included a video showcasing the team’s vision for what gamers may expect from the partnership. There’s an Odogaron-inspired suit of armor, a skin for Eivor’s ride that makes it look like he’s riding an actual Odogaron around England, and a skin that transforms Eivor’s scout into a cute little Legiana.

Several of the weapons available to Eivor in Monster Hunter World were also highlighted in the collaborative event video. Both the Garon Hatchet and Garon Rod are based on real weapons from Monster Hunter World but have been adapted for use in the world of Assassin’s Creed: Valhalla. How do I start the crossover quest in Valhalla?

The first requirement for accessing A Fated Encounter is completing the task In Dreams and constructing Valka’s Hut. The initial quest, A Distorted Dream at Raventhorpe, becomes available once Valka’s Hut has been built and In Dreams has been finished.

How old is Kassandra in AC Valhalla crossover?

In AC Valhalla Crossover Stories, Kassandra and Eivor meet in the 9th century CE, when Kassandra is around 1300 years old. Her father, Pythagoras, bestowed upon her the Staff of Hermes, a very potent Piece of Eden, so that she would live forever in AC Odyssey.
